“Motivation is found all by itself” in Toulouse, assures Lebel

Despite last season’s European Cup-championship double, “the desire is still there” at Stade Toulousain, international winger Matthis Lebel assured AFP ahead of an unprecedented trip to Vannes on Sunday to close the first day of the Top 14.

QUESTION: How do you find the motivation to start a new season knowing that it won’t be possible to do better than the previous one?

ANSWER: “We all came back with a smile on our face. The desire is still there. The desire to go and get more great things, to continue writing our story… The motivation comes naturally because we are lucky to have a very competitive group, with strong characters. There is also a great emulation with the young people who are coming up.”

Q: Is the pleasure still the same after the two Champions Cups and four Brennus Shields won since 2019?

A: “There are siblings in the team, lots of stories of friendship, players who have followed each other since they were little. We don’t want it to stop. Fun is really an integral part of our group. We never get tired of the guys who are here, of being among ourselves, of laughing… Maybe that’s the secret in the end. We’ll do the math much later, but there is a positive energy in this group.”

Q: Do you assume your status as huge favorites for this new season?

A: “It’s nice and flattering of everyone, but we have to be very vigilant. We mustn’t let ourselves fall asleep and think that all it takes is to put on the jersey. We know that we’re going to be expected at every match, that for our opponents the motivation will be even greater to face Stade Toulousain. All the Top 14 clubs are working hard and arming themselves to be able to go as far as possible in one or two competitions. There are some extremely intelligent recruits in several teams.”

Q: Like the last one-sided final against Bordeaux-Bègles (59-3), you still seem to have a certain margin on the competition…

A: “The coaches are doing a great job so that we can respond to all the problems that we may be asked during matches. We must continue to cultivate it every day in training, to keep this confidence and this bond between us. To say that we are the only ones would be a delusion. On the other hand, having confidence in ourselves and wanting to continue to do our little bit of work, we have the right to say that.”

Q: On a personal level, do you have the ambition to win your place in the French team, with which you only played one match last season after missing the World Cup?

A: “We’re going to do things in order and try to start the season as well as possible. Before thinking about the French team, club performances are the most important. Those are the ones that are judged. There’s already a huge emulation within the club. I was injured (in the back) at the end of the season. So we’ll have to get going again, keep going and have as much fun as possible. Afterwards, if the performances are there, why not go and see what’s happening a little higher up. But that’s not my responsibility.”

Q: What status do you have today within this Toulouse team?

A: “I don’t think I’m the young guy who’s just coming up anymore. I’ve been lucky enough to be in the group for seven years now. The relationship with the coaches has already changed, with a certain possibility of speaking. Afterwards, players like Antoine Dupont, Julien Marchand, Thomas Ramos, Romain Ntamack have an aura over the group that no longer needs to be proven. Let’s say that there are executives, but also the executives of the executives, who are well represented (smile).”
